PACR of a project (5/89-3/95)to investigate the complex relationships between Maize Rayado Fino virus (MRFV), its insect vector, and tolerant and susceptible cultivars of maize.

Abstract
The project was implemented by the University of Costa Rica (UCR). The project accomplished its main targets and, in some cases, surpassed expected goals. Notably, the project identified the coat protein gene, as well as maize germplasm lines exhibiting tolerance/resistance to the virus; it also examined the geographic distribution of MRFV and strain diversity (information valuable to determining factors which influence the epidemiology of the disease). The nucleotide sequence of the geographically diverse isolates is useful in order to design better constructions for engineering MRFV-resistant maize. In addition, the project improved the infrastructure of the UCR by building a modern greenhouse, and purchasing a freezer, cold chamber, water bath, and orbital shaker. Several graduate students received their MSc. degrees while being trained and supported from this grant. The following lessons were learned. (1) The project has allowed the introduction of new technology into UCR's biology research department by training UCR scientists in a U.S. laboratory. Planning and performing experiments by both Costa Rican and U.S. laboratories working as a team has yielded many interesting and useful results. Many molecular techniques that are essential to a plant pathologist, such as polymerase chain reaction (PCR), nuclear hybridization, cDNA cloning, and nucleic acid sequencing, have been acquired by the UCR scientists through this collaboration, which will enhance their ability to diagnose plant diseases rapidly and reliably and to creatively develop means for disease control.
